To a suspension of 2-(3,4-dichlorophenyl)acetic acid (137 mg, 0.67 mmol) in DCE (2.0 mL) was added oxalyl chloride (908 μL, 1.82 mmol, 2.0M solution in CH2Cl2) (0.908 mL, 1.816 mmol) followed by one drop of DMF. The resulting reaction mixture was stirred at room temperature for 40 min and then concentrated in vacuo. To a solution of the crude residue in MeCN (4.0 mL) was added indoline-5-sulfonamide (120 mg, 0.61 mmol) and K2CO3 (167 mg, 1.21 mmol). The reaction mixture was stirred at room temperature for 1 h. Additional indoline-5-sulfonamide (40 mg, 0.20 mmol) was added, and the reaction mixture was allowed to stir at room temperature overnight. The reaction mixture was then diluted with EtOAc and sat. aq. NaHCO3 solution. The organic layer was washed with 10% aq. LiCl solution and then dried over MgSO4, filtered and concentrated in vacuo. The residue was triturated with CH2Cl2 to give the title compound (180 mg, 77%) as a pale yellow solid. 1H NMR (DMSO-d6) δ 8.11 (d, J=8.4 Hz, 1H), 7.59 (m, 4H), 7.29 (dd, J=8.1, 2.0 Hz, 1H), 7.22 (s, 2H), 4.26 (t, J=8.5 Hz, 2H), 3.94 (s, 2H), 3.24 (t, J=8.5 Hz, 2H); MS(ESI+) m/z 385.0 (M+H)+.
